Kisuke Urahara Graffiti for CS 1.6

Integrate a touch of anime flair into your Counter-Strike 1.6 matches with the Kisuke Urahara graffiti. Drawn from the iconic Bleach series, this spray features the enigmatic shopkeeper and ex-captain in his signature hat and coat, capturing his sly grin and mysterious vibe. Place it on walls during intense de_dust2 rounds or cs_office hideouts to mark territory or taunt opponents subtly. In CS 1.6's fast-paced environment, graffiti like this adds personality without disrupting hitbox alignment or server performance.

Installation Guide for Kisuke Urahara Graffiti

Adding this graffiti to your CS 1.6 install takes under a minute. It's designed for straightforward deployment, avoiding common mod pitfalls like overwritten sprites or compatibility issues with custom configs.

  1. Download the .zip archive from a trusted source – always scan with antivirus first.
  2. Extract the .spr and .res files to your cstrike/gfx/graffiti folder (typically in your SteamApps/common/Half-Life/cstrike directory).
  3. Launch CS 1.6 and test in a local server: Open console with ~, type 'give graffiti' or use the buy menu under equipment.
  4. For quick spraying, add a bind to your autoexec.cfg: bind mouse4 "+spray; wait; -spray" – adjust for your setup.
  5. Verify in-game: Join a bot match on de_inferno and spray near A-site to check for texture pop-in or color accuracy.

If you're running a clean config, this mod won't conflict with no-recoil scripts or visibility packs. For Non-Steam users, place files in the base cstrike dir and restart the game executable.
